Originally posted by pearl93max
93 VG....toped out tonight accually, about 120....tach reads just under 5 grand, but won't go any faster, weird!!?? plus it's a crappy auto
It won't go any faster because the engine just doesn't have any more power up there to MAKE it go faster. That is called your top speed limited by drag! Yes the manual will get more top speed but not much 5 or 10 mph for a 5-spd VG.
